Internal character almost totally C15.
Vestry once used as school: alphabet letters painted in C18 script on south wall: chamfer mould panelled roof, one carved centre boss.
fine traceried kingpost roof with end drops onto angel corbels, leaf bosses, more elaborate than chancel: aisles have simpler roofs with only east bays panelled.
pulpit C18: fine collection of mostly Cl6 bench ends, one dated 1538, and on east wall of south aisle three misericords of c1400.
